Invite Others
Do you know someone who is interested in the arts? Community development? Invite them to Grand Beginnings. Join us for a light breakfast and a tour and presentation of Grand Street Community Arts. It happens every 1st Thursday of the month from 8:00 AM – 9:00 AM. The tour begins at our Arts Center on 68 Grand Street.
Help Us Renovate
Our ongoing work on our Arts Center, former St. Anthony’s, benefits from the work of many skilled and unskilled volunteers. We hold several work parties a year and they are a great opportunity to learn new skills and meet the local community.

Community Development
We are spearheading an effort to transform South End vacant lots into usable community space. We are looking for community members and volunteers to help us select a vacant lot and develop a project proposal to be submitted to the property owner. Grand Street Community Arts is looking for community improvement projects that incorporate art and gardening.
